Section 87-2-116 - Base hunting license prerequisite for other hunting licenses - fee
(1) To be eligible to apply for a hunting license or Class A-2 special bow and arrow license, a person must first obtain a base hunting license as provided in this section. The base hunting license must be purchased once each license year.
(2) Resident base hunting licenses may be purchased for a fee of $10, of which $2 is a hunting access fee that must be used by the department to fund programs authorized in 87-1-265.
(3) Nonresident base hunting licenses may be purchased for a fee of $15, of which $10 is a hunting access fee that must be used by the department to fund programs authorized in 87-1-265.
